Sign any text with your RSA Key and get the RSA-SHA1 signature.
[Detail]
Generate the RSA-SHA1 signature for any Plain Text string using your RSA Key in XML format.
Included functions:
RSASHA1Sign - Give it a Private Key XML and a Plain Text and get the Base64 encoded RSA-SHA1 signature.
Note that the RSASHA1Sign function expects your key to be given in XML format. If you need to convert your PEM key into XML format, you can take a look at this online RSA key converter:
https://superdry.apphb.com/tools/online-rsa-key-converter
As a precaution, I would recommend hosting your own version, to protect your key.
